Summary

BSE has announced changes to the Short Term Additional Surveillance Measure (ST-ASM) framework effective December 01, 2025. Six securities are being added to the ST-ASM framework, while eight securities are moving out. The circular provides consolidated lists of all securities under ST-ASM surveillance with their respective stages.

Key Points

  • 6 securities shortlisted for ST-ASM framework including Best Agrolife Ltd, Gilada Finance & Investments Ltd, Halder Venture Ltd, JD Cables Ltd, Srigee Dlm Ltd, and Supertech Ev Ltd
  • 3 of the newly added securities are SME scrips (JD Cables Ltd, Srigee Dlm Ltd, Supertech Ev Ltd)
  • 8 securities moving out of ST-ASM framework: Garnet International Ltd, Magellanic Cloud Ltd, Parmeshwar Metal Ltd, Regal Entertainment & Consultants Ltd, Universal Cables Ltd, Venus Remedies Ltd, VL E-Governance & IT Solutions Ltd, and VLS Finance Ltd
  • Securities moving out are being included in other surveillance frameworks: LT-ASM (Magellanic Cloud Ltd), ESM (Regal Entertainment & Consultants Ltd, Venus Remedies Ltd), or exiting surveillance
  • No securities moving to higher or lower stages within ST-ASM framework
  • Consolidated list shows securities across multiple stages (I through VII) with varying ASM levels

Regulatory Changes

The ST-ASM framework applies enhanced surveillance measures to securities exhibiting unusual price movements or volatility. Securities in this framework are subject to:

  • Short term surveillance periods (5/15/30 days)
  • Staged approach with progressive restrictions
  • Special monitoring for SME scrips and T+0 securities
  • Potential migration to other surveillance frameworks (LT-ASM, ESM, GSM, Trade for Trade, Pledge Framework)

Additional Information

Securities Added to ST-ASM (Stage I)

  1. Best Agrolife Ltd (539660, INE052T01013) - Also listed per NSE
  2. Gilada Finance & Investments Ltd (538788, INE918C01029)
  3. Halder Venture Ltd (539854, INE115S01010)
  4. JD Cables Ltd (544524, INE14VP01014) - SME Scrip
  5. Srigee Dlm Ltd (544399, INE0RJ901010) - SME Scrip
  6. Supertech Ev Ltd (544428, INE0SC101013) - SME Scrip

Securities Exiting ST-ASM

  • Moving to LT-ASM: Magellanic Cloud Ltd
  • Moving to ESM: Regal Entertainment & Consultants Ltd, Venus Remedies Ltd
  • Exiting Surveillance: Garnet International Ltd, Parmeshwar Metal Ltd (SME), Universal Cables Ltd, VL E-Governance & IT Solutions Ltd, VLS Finance Ltd
